ASL XD6000SN/G Digital Projector Lamp for NEC NC-Series Cinema Projectors
The ASL XD6000SN/G is a 6000 W digital xenon replacement projector lamp for NEC NC2500S, NC3200S, NC3240S 4kW, and NC3240S 7kW cinema projectors, rated at 600 hours and cross-referenced to USHIO DXL-60SN and LTI XDC-6000N.Overview
The ASL XD6000SN/G is a high-wattage 6000 W digital xenon replacement lamp designed for NEC's largest NC-series cinema projectors. Rated at 600 hours, it is suited to high-output cinema auditoriums where maximum screen brightness is a priority. Cross-references to LTI LTIX-6000W-DN, LTI XDC-6000N, and USHIO DXL-60SN confirm specification compliance for these NEC projection systems.
Key Features
- Compatible with NEC NC2500S, NC3200S, NC3240S 4kW, NC3240S 7kW
- 600-hour rated lamp life
- 6000 W digital xenon source for maximum cinema brightness
- Cross-referenced with LTI LTIX-6000W-DN, LTI XDC-6000N, USHIO DXL-60SN
Specifications
- Lamp Type: Digital Xenon
- Lamp Life: 600 hours
- Compatible Models: NEC NC2500S, NC3200S, NC3240S 4kW, NC3240S 7kW
- Cross References: LTI LTIX-6000W-DN, LTI XDC-6000N, USHIO DXL-60SN
- Brand: ASL
- Weight: 0.45 kg

FAQ
Q: Why does this 6000 W lamp have fewer rated hours than the 4500 W model?
A: Higher-wattage lamps typically have shorter rated lives due to the greater thermal and electrical stress on the arc tube. The 600-hour rating is standard for 6000 W cinema xenon lamps.
Q: Which NEC models is the XD6000SN/G compatible with?
A: NEC NC2500S, NC3200S, NC3240S 4kW, and NC3240S 7kW.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the NEC projector models compatible with the XD6000SN/G lamp?
This lamp is engineered for NEC NC2500S, NC3200S, NC3240S 4kW, and NC3240S 7kW cinema projectors. It is not compatible with older NEC series (NC1600C, NC2000C) or any non-NEC projector; verify your exact model before purchasing.
How does the 6000 W power rating compare to lower-wattage cinema lamps?
The 6000 W rating represents NEC's highest-power cinema lamp option, delivering maximum luminous output for the largest screens and brightest auditoriums. This wattage is engineered for venues requiring exceptional brightness performance.
What does the 600-hour service rating mean for high-power lamp operations?
At 600 hours, this is the shortest-life lamp in NEC's lineup, reflecting the intense thermal stress of 6000 W operation. Venues using this lamp should expect replacement every 4-5 months and plan budgets accordingly for frequent cycling.
Why is the XD6000SN/G lamp rated for significantly shorter service (600 hours) than lower-wattage variants?
High-power lamps operate at thermal limits to maximize brightness. The arc tube experiences greater stress at 6000 W, reducing service life. This trade-off between peak brightness and longevity is inherent to the highest-performance cinema lamp category.
Which venues would benefit most from the XD6000SN/G instead of lower-wattage alternatives?
Venues with large IMAX-scale screens, premium auditoriums requiring maximum brightness for commercial success, or venues in regions with bright ambient light conditions benefit most from 6000 W lamp performance.
What heat and cooling management is critical for safe 6000 W lamp operation?
The projector's cooling system must be perfectly maintained—filters must be clean, ventilation unobstructed, and ambient temperature below 25°C. Any cooling system neglect will shorten lamp life dramatically and risk equipment damage.

How does the 6000 W lamp's brightness compare to the 4500 W alternative?
The 6000 W lamp delivers noticeably higher brightness (roughly 33% more luminous output) than the 4500 W variant, providing superior image impact on large screens. The trade-off is more frequent replacement (600 vs 1000 hours).
